Job Description

LD&D, a rapidly growing Miami-based real estate development and investment firm, is seeking an Investment Associate to join the team for a Spring or Summer 2026 start date. We are looking for a highly analytical and motivated individual who values teamwork and is eager to contribute to the company's growth. 

The ideal candidate will be capable of analyzing the performance of the firm’s assets, underwriting new investment opportunities that align with the firm's investment theses, and modeling complex deal structures. This role involves reporting directly to the Vice President of Investments and entails close collaboration with the investment team and senior management across all stages of the development/investment cycle. 

Key Responsibilities: 

• Build and maintain financial models for development, acquisition, and asset-level investments, incorporating complex capital structures, promote waterfalls, and return analyses (IRR, MOIC, NPV). 

• Support the sourcing, underwriting, and execution of new investment opportunities across ground-up development and value-add strategies. 

• Coordinate due diligence efforts including review of third-party reports, financial statements, leases, and market studies to ensure smooth and timely closings. 

• Collaborate with development and asset management teams to track business plan execution, update project-level models, and monitor performance versus budget. 

• Assist in capital markets activities, including lender and equity partner outreach, financial deliverables, and preparation of offering memoranda and investor presentations. 

• Prepare internal and external materials, including investment committee memos, pipeline summaries, and quarterly investor updates. 

• Conduct market research and data analysis on rents, sales, construction costs, and macroeconomic trends to inform underwriting assumptions and strategic decisions. 

Qualifications: 

• Bachelor’s degree in finance, economics, or a related field; Master’s degree a plus. 

• 1+ years of experience in real estate, investment banking, private equity, or a related field. 

• Strong analytical and quantitative skills, with proficiency in financial modeling. 

• Excellent communication and presentation skills. 

• Ability to travel and manage a workload, as required by the projects. 

•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ment and independently. 

LD&D offers a competitive salary based on experience and full healthcare benefits.
